Welcome to ISKAY BOUTIQUE HOSTEL, a cozy 3-star hotel located at 266 Santa Cruz 525 in La Paz, Bolivia. This charming boutique hostel is just 0.8mi from the city center, offering a convenient location for exploring the vibrant streets of La Paz. With 1019 reviews, guests have raved about the stunning mountain and landmark views, free Wi-Fi, live music performances, and 24-hour front desk service. The hotel starts at an affordable $17 per night and provides a delicious breakfast to start your day off right.
This unique hostel provides a range of amenities to make your stay comfortable and enjoyable. From soundproof rooms to a pet-friendly policy, ISKAY BOUTIQUE HOSTEL offers something for every traveler. Explore the city with ease using the shuttle service and return to enjoy a refreshing drink at the bar or a meal at the on-site restaurant. The hotel also offers wheelchair accessible rooms and an elevator for convenience.

What's the check-in and check-out schedule at ISKAY BOUTIQUE HOSTEL?
ISKAY BOUTIQUE HOSTEL accommodates check-ins starting from 01:00 PM and ending at 11:00 PM. The rooms should be vacated by 12:00 PM.
What are the rates at ISKAY BOUTIQUE HOSTEL?
A stay at ISKAY BOUTIQUE HOSTEL can begin from a rate of $17. This is subject to change based on room selection and travel dates. For a clear price, input your desired stay dates.
Which room categories can I book at ISKAY BOUTIQUE HOSTEL?
The hotel offers dormitory rooms with bunk beds for single occupancy, with a room size of 301 sqft, and no smoking allowed. There are also suite options such as the Deluxe Suite and Deluxe Queen Suite, accommodating 2 adults, with a Queen size bed and no smoking allowed. Additionally, there are triple rooms with private bathrooms, accommodating 3 adults with Twin beds and no smoking allowed.
